Discussion The main findings of this study using a nationwide surveillance database in Japan were as follows: (1) for the incidences of total SSIs and deep or organ/space SSIs, the analysis model adjusted for seasonality was more appropriate than the unadjusted model, with seasonality peaking in summer; (2) in Japan, the incidences of total SSIs and SSIs due to MRSA showed a decreasing trend regardless of the COVID-19 pandemic; and (3) interrupted time series analysis revealed that the COVID-19 pandemic had no demonstrable immediate impact on the monthly incidences of total SSIs, deep or organ/space SSIs, or SSIs due to MRSA following orthopaedic surgery.
